If you lift your 4WD then you need an alignment correction solution to fix the geometry change in your 4WD’s suspension. This can be achieved with a SuperPro alignment correction bushing kit or a SuperPro Adjustable Upper Control Arm Kit. In some cases a suspension bushings will not be able to correct the alignment issues that arise when you lift you vehicle, such as droop. This is when a SuprPro Upper Control Arm Kit is the better solution, particularly with lifted IFS 4WD.
These bushings are often overlooked when upgrading the suspension of a 4WD. As the OEM rubber bushings deteriorate they induce undesirable characteristics into the handling of any vehicle. Having an independent front suspension on this vehicle means the OEM bushes work very hard and durability, reliability and performance are compromised. Leaf spring bushings stabilise the movement of the rear axle, inferior bushes in this area will cause the solid rear axle to move and impart rear end passive steer to the vehicle. It also causes the vehicle to "wander" all over the road and be unstable under heavy braking. This can be especially noticeable carrying a load or towing a boat or caravan. The OE rubber style bushes are designed to work at standard height with standard tyres and with standard loads. By fitting and upgrading to SuperPro Bushings the rear end of your 4WD will handle just about anything you can throw at it!

SKU: SPF3892KControl arm bushes stabilise the movement of the arms to ensure the correct geometry is maintained in all situations. Worn or rubber bushes in these locations lead to dynamic changes in wheel alignment that effect the handling of a vehicle as well as the tyre life. SuperPro Bushing solve this issue as and add the ability to 'tune' the wheel alignment to suit the specific requirements of vehicle and driver.
SKU: SPF3800-32KSway Bar mount bushes are an important part of the whole sway bar system. Worn or rubber bushes in these locations lead to movement in the sway bar in unwanted directions that effect the effectiveness of the sway bar. An upgrade to SuperPro bushings can return lost sway bar performance and improve handling.
